Here is my KM sword with one of my KM daggers.
The sword is apparently a private purchase with no Nord or Ostsee number. It has an ivory grip and came with original hangers, portepee and sword bag (not shown here). The dagger is a Lueneschloss with a glass (or amber?) grip and a rayon portepee. The dagger hangers, well, they are just hangers.
